Имя: Пароль:
1C
1С v8
Запись формулы при формировании табличного документа, который сохраняется в xls
0 hame1e00n
 
29.05.13
10:41
Добрый день, коллеги!

Есть документ, который содержит прайс по ценам на номенклатуру.
Из него формируется табличный документ вида:

Номенклатура     Количество      Цена       Сумма

Заполняется только номенклатура и цена.
Далее таб. док. сохраняется как файл экселя и прикладывается к письму (все делается автоматически).

Но руководство хочет, чтобы клиенты когда получали файлик, подставляли нужное им количество и сразу видели сумму, то есть в ячейке суммы стояла формула "=RC[-2]*RC[-1]".

Так и делаю. Но в таб. документе и потом в экселевсков файле так текстом и написано в ячейке "=RC[-2]*RC[-1]". Как сделать, чтобы это было именно формулой, а не значением?
1 hame1e00n
 
29.05.13
10:42
Ап!
2 mikecool
 
29.05.13
10:43
писать напрямую в эксель файл
3 hame1e00n
 
29.05.13
10:43
Если потом в сформированном файле устанавливаю курсор на эту ячейку и нажимаю ентер, то значение преобразуется в формулу, но хочется сразу...
4 hame1e00n
 
29.05.13
10:48
(2) придется полностью переписывать существующий механизм, имеется в виду формирование файла? или можно с минимальными доработками? Там просто кнфигурация писанная-переписанная, еще много чего завязано на этой отправке...
5 ptiz
 
29.05.13
10:53
(3) Через OLE подключаться к Екселю и обрабатывать сфомированный документ.
6 hame1e00n
 
29.05.13
11:03
(5), (2) Спасибо, попробую так :-)